Analysis

In 2015, state capacity index in Dominican Republic stood at 0.5986.

That represents a change of down 3.5% on the previous year and up 99.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, state capacity index in Dominican Republic peaked at 0.6204 in 2014 and was at its lowest, -0.6036, in 1973.

That places Dominican Republic 74th out of 165 countries with data for 2015,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s -0.2545 -0.5713 0.0347 10
1970s -0.511 -0.6036 -0.3688 10
1980s -0.3508 -0.511 -0.1976 10
1990s 0.0354 -0.3709 0.4533 10
2000s 0.3726 0.2096 0.5134 10
2010s 0.5531 0.4665 0.6204 6

Measures state capacity by combining 21 different indicators related to three key dimensions: extractive capacity, coercive capacity, and administrative capacity. Higher values indicate greater state capacity.
